From the Outback to the Last Frontier: USAF and RAAF participate
Pilots, security forces, aircraft maintainers and logistics personnel from the Royal Australian Air Force (left) and the U.S. Air Force (right) pose in front of an F-35A Lightning II assigned to the 355th Fighter Squadron during RED FLAG-Alaska 21-3 on Eielson Air Force Base, Alaska, Aug. 27, 2021. This iteration of the exercise focused on the interoperability of allied fifth-generation assets, such as the F-35A Lightning II, as well as cyber and intelligence warfare capabilities.
